This is a review of the reformulated version. The old ones were gloppy and opaque. The new ones are sheer, shimmery and smooth. Love the formula.
This is the truest chocolate scent and flavour I have ever found in a lip gloss. It's HG material for that alone. However, this is far too brown on me and makes me look like I have dirty lips. It's sad, but that's okay. I use this when I'm alone and need a quick pick me up. The clear Cool Mint version is my everyday gloss.
If you have very pigmented lips and look good in browns, this is a great brown with gold shimmer. I could absolutely see this being a gorgeous gloss on the right woman.

I was lucky and got both the original and newer reformulated versions today. The old color was simply a darker, solid brown with suble shimmers, whereas the newer one is drastically lighter: a caramel brown with shimmers. To tell the truth, I don't really like the older color b/c it looks like mud on my very pigmented lips. However, I can't really pass judgement since my tanned, olive (NC35ish) face simply did not need any more brown on it - a mistake on my part. I give it lippies for being very pigmented, though! I liked the reformulated color better, but I was hoping for a lighter color than what showed up on my lips: it looked like I had put on clear lipgloss with shimmer in it. A little disappointing, as I was looking for something to replace my BonneBell Liplites in Metallic Mocha (a very slight milky brown). Also, the texture was not to my liking; sure it was sticky enough to stay, but not sticky enough for my preference (I love L'Oreal's ColourJuices). But, I can see how others would like it. Finally, these lipglosses do not part shine or gloss - I compared to my BB LipLites, and the difference is WAY off: the NYC Chocolate Fudge looks extremely dull compared to it. Final Verdict: Pros - love the smell!, texture is likeable (not greasy or too sticky), and price ($3), but Cons - no taste (I guess that can be good in some cases), no shine or gloss, and not a very good color for me.
